NEW HAVEN, Conn. - The Albertus Magnus College women's tennis team begins its first season in the City University of New York Athletic Conference (CUNYAC) as it released its 11 game schedule for the 2025 season.
Albertus begins its season at Celentano Courts as it hosts Sarah Lawrence College in a non-conference tilt on September 7th.
A week long long trip for the Falcons is filled with five matches, including their first CUNYAC game against York (NY) on September 11. Following York, the Falcons will play John Jay and Baruch on September 12th and 13th, respectively before two matches on September 14th against Division I University of New Haven.
The Falcons return home to host Brooklyn College in a conference battle on September 27th to start a three-match homestand.
Hunter College - the defending CUNYAC champions - visits Albertus on October 1st in a CUNYAC game followed by a match against Western Connecticut State University (WCSU) the following day in a non-conference match.
After a 15-day layoff, Albertus will take on WCSU again in Danbury, Conn. for an October 17th match. The Falcons close out their season the next day in a CUNYAC match against Lehman.
The CUNYAC Championships begin on Tuesday, October 28th at the USTA National Tennis Center in Flushing, N.Y.
